Jay-Z used to battle Busta Rhymes in playground
Jay-Z used to battle Busta Rhymes in the school playground, he has revealed. The star said: "Going to school with Busta Rhymes and Biggie was cool.
"We used to battle each other at lunchtimes. I got Busta good. I was rapping really fast and everyone was like 'wow'." But despite his childhood antics, he said he didn't want to be famous. He said: "Music was just my escape. I wanted a way out from where I was, I had no aspirations to be a superstar. I just wanted a job. I was into a lot of crazy things, and music was my way out." He added: "I had simple goals when making the first album. It was for a select group of people, people just like me. I wanted to impress the guys who were living that life." Jay-Z also revealed that he couldn't wait to take on US president Barack Obama. He said: "Barack professes to be this great basketball player. I can't wait to get him on the court because you know I can play a bit."
